Output d95b9f2f4bb51dd93c607211aedd90b1ba355b4fa0b5b1ed45e1c7a1bb294c08:59

value
2102541
script pubkey
OP_0 OP_PUSHBYTES_20 379e935f765b3725437f3e240e9b7bc257a07407
address
bc1qx70fxhmktvmj2sml8cjqaxmmcft6qaq8dewl8x
transaction
d95b9f2f4bb51dd93c607211aedd90b1ba355b4fa0b5b1ed45e1c7a1bb294c08
confirmations
156126
spent
true